Gordon Li

Gordon L6149 has not set their biography yet

Posted by on in Blogs
C++Builder 10.2除錯新功能 在C++Builder 10.2中有一個新的除錯功能是很多C/C++用戶長久以來不斷提出的要求, 那就是要能對不同命名空間或是不同執行範圍內擁有相同名稱的變數在除錯時能夠正確的觀察變數值, 在10.2版中這個好用的除錯小功能終於被加入了除錯器中. 如果讀者不太瞭解上面內容的說明, 那麼讓我們使用一個簡單的小範例來示範這個新除錯功能, 相信您一定很快就會瞭解.   例如在下面的CallFooWithSameNames()方法中有一個名為iSameNameValue的區域變數, 而在for迴圈中筆者也刻意宣告了同樣名稱為iSameNameValue的for迴圈區域變數.當使用10.2的除錯器時如果把中斷點設在for迴圈中的iSameNameValue, 我們可以看到新的除錯器偵測到現在是在for迴圈, 因此iSameNameValue此時的變數值是未定的而不是for迴圈外設定的1111, 這是正確的. 另外請注意左上方的呼叫堆疊視窗中現在每個方法之前都加入了類別名稱以避免不同類別擁有相同名稱方法的困擾:   再看下面的畫面, 當權行點離開了for迴圈後iS...

Posted by on in Blogs
C++Builder 10.2除错新功能 在C++Builder 10.2中有一个新的除错功能是很多C/C++用户长久以来不断提出的要求, 那就是要能对不同命名空间或是不同执行范围内拥有相同名称的变量在除错时能够正确的观察变量值, 在10.2版中这个好用的除错小功能终于被加入了除错器中.   如果读者不太了解上面内容的说明, 那么让我们使用一个简单的小范例来示范这个新除错功能, 相信您一定很快就会了解.     例如在下面的CallFooWithSameNames()方法中有一个名为iSameNameValue的局部变量, 而在for循环中笔者也刻意宣告了同样名称为iSameNameValue的for循环局部变量.当使用10.2的除错器时如果把断点设在for循环中的iSameNameValue, 我们可以看到新的除错器侦测到现在是在for循环, 因此iSameNameValue此时的变量值是未定的而不是for循环外设定的1111, 这是正确的. 另外请注意左上方的呼叫堆栈窗口中现在每个方法之前都加入了类别名称以避免不同类别拥有相同名称方法的困扰:   再看下面的画面, ...

Posted by on in Blogs
RAD Studio Tokyo版连结MariaDB 10.1.22 在上次的文章写完不久之后RAD Studio Tokyo版很快的就推出了正式版, 在说明文件中正式提到支持MariaDB:   http://docwiki.embarcadero.com/RADStudio/Tokyo/en/What%27s_New   MariaDB和MySQL有着非常密切的关系, 因此只要使用RAD Studio Tokyo版中的FireDAC就可以连结到MariaDB. 首先先到   https://downloads.mariadb.org/mariadb/10.1.22/   下载MariaDB, MariaDB同时支持Windows和Ubuntu, Red Hat平台, 都是RAD Studio Tokyo版支援的平台.     笔者下载的是Win 64平台, 安装完之后到RAD Studio IDE中, 开启Data Explorer页面,在MySQL Server之下建立MaraiDB的连结:   之后拖曳MariaDB数据表到FireMoney窗体上...

Posted by on in Blogs
RAD Studio Tokyo版連結MariaDB 10.1.22 在上次的文章寫完不久之後RAD Studio Tokyo版很快的就推出了正式版, 在說明文件中正式提到支援MariaDB:   http://docwiki.embarcadero.com/RADStudio/Tokyo/en/What%27s_New   MariaDB和MySQL有著非常密切的關係, 因此只要使用RAD Studio Tokyo版中的FireDAC就可以連結到MariaDB. 首先先到   https://downloads.mariadb.org/mariadb/10.1.22/   下載MariaDB, MariaDB同時支援Windows和Ubuntu, Red Hat平台, 都是RAD Studio Tokyo版支援的平台.     筆者下載的是Win 64平台, 安裝完之後到RAD Studio IDE中, 開啟Data Explorer頁面,在MySQL Server之下建立MaraiDB的連結:   之後拖曳MariaDB資料表到FireMoney表單上...

Posted by on in Blogs
RAD Studio Tokyo台灣發表會 今天一早起床就看到RAD Studio Tokyo版正式推出了, 這也代表終於不再受封口令的限制了, RAD Studio Tokyo在台灣的發表會日期也很快的確定了:   時間: 2:00pm~4:30pm 4/11 (二) 高雄 蓮潭會館103 會議室          高雄市左營區崇德路801號   4/12 (三) 台中 日內瓦會議中心 亞洲廳 12*7.5/28 (長寬高) 台中市西區忠明南路303號 17 F  http://www.a23021155.idv.tw/         4/13 (四)  台北  中國文化大學推廣教育部 APA 藝文中心 國際會議廳           台北市建國南路二段231 號 B1     好久沒有隨著E...

Posted by on in Blogs
大陆RAD Studio Tokyo发表会 今天一早起床就看到RAD Studio Tokyo版正式推出了, 这也代表终于不再受封口令的限制了, RAD Studio Tokyo在大陆的发表会日期也很快的确定了:   4/19 (三) 北京  北京唯实酒店(唯实国际文化交流中心)二层昆仑多功能厅 (长19.6米 宽12米) 北京市海淀区学院路39号   4/21 (五) 深圳  深圳中洲圣廷苑酒店 多功能2厅 深圳福田区华强北路4002号   好久没有随着Embarcadero做产品发表了, 趁着这次的发表会也可以和许多久未见面的朋友叙叙旧了, 只是这次的发表会有一不小的挑战, 希望到时能一切顺利....

Posted by on in Blogs
Delphi在Linux平台支援的資料庫 隨著Delphi Tokyo版即將推出的腳步愈來愈近, 也開始注意Delphi在Linux平台上可以藉由FireDAC支援的資料庫有那些, 當然除了Oracle, Sybase等之外, InterBase也可以跑在Ubuntu和RedHat之中, 當然MySQL也可以. 此外Delphi For Linux的FireDAC似乎也可以支援 MariaDB, 這到是不錯的功能,   https://mariadb.org/     到時候可以試試FireDAC對於MariaDB支援的程度如何, 現在只能靜心等待Delphi Tokyo版的正式推出了....

Posted by on in Blogs
Delphi在Linux平台支持的数据库 随着Delphi Tokyo版即将推出的脚步愈来愈近, 也开始注意Delphi在Linux平台上可以藉由FireDAC支持的数据库有那些, 当然除了Oracle, Sybase等之外, InterBase也可以跑在Ubuntu和RedHat之中, 当然MySQL也可以. 此外Delphi For Linux的FireDAC似乎也可以支持 MariaDB, 这到是不错的功能,   https://mariadb.org/     到时候可以试试FireDAC对于MariaDB支持的程度如何, 现在只能静心等待Delphi Tokyo版的正式推出了....

Posted by on in Blogs
耐心等待新版Delphi的發表 雖然有NDA的限制, 但最近看到Embarcadero本身已經開始揭露各種下一版Delphi的資訊時, 心中想著大概已經快要接近最後完成的階段了, 經過多年的研發, 當初要讓Delphi支援Linux的夢想即將實現.   下一版Delphi的主要功能就是支援Linux的開發, 現在也確定主要支援Red Hat和Ubuntu, 歐洲已經有預覽研討會   https://community.embarcadero.com/blogs/entry/rad-studio-10-2-tokyo-preview-event-in-prague-today   Embarcadero也在3月15日開放註冊參加線上研討會: https://attendee.gotowebinar.com/register/4272477166706493185     除了支援Linux之外其他的新功能仍然不明確, 這只能等待Embarcadero發表下一版Delphi時才能知道了, 不過這一天應該很快就會到來....

Posted by on in Blogs
等待下一版Delphi的发表 虽然有NDA的限制, 但最近看到Embarcadero本身已经开始揭露各种下一版Delphi的信息时, 心中想着大概已经快要接近最后完成的阶段了, 经过多年的研发, 当初要让Delphi支持Linux的梦想即将实现.   下一版Delphi的主要功能就是支持Linux的开发, 现在也确定主要支持Red Hat和Ubuntu, 欧洲已经有预览研讨会   https://community.embarcadero.com/blogs/entry/rad-studio-10-2-tokyo-preview-event-in-prague-today   Embarcadero也在3月15日开放注册参加在线研讨会: https://attendee.gotowebinar.com/register/4272477166706493185     除了支持Linux之外其他的新功能仍然不明确, 这只能等待Embarcadero发表下一版Delphi时才能知道了, 不过这一天应该很快就会到来....

Check out more tips and tricks in this development video: